Innovative open-source projects turn standard Android smartphones into local SMS gateways. By running a native app (often built with Kotlin or Java) on an Android device, these tools expose an HTTP API endpoint. When the endpoint receives a request, the app utilizes the phone's local SIM card to send the message.
